10.2 C
Manchester
November 7, 2024
Image default
Technical

The Role of Machine Learning in Predictive Analytics

The Role of Machine Learning in Predictive Analytics

Predictive analytics has gained significant importance in recent years, as organizations across industries strive to make data-driven decisions and gain a competitive advantage. The ability to accurately predict future outcomes has become crucial for optimizing operations, enhancing customer experiences, and identifying new business opportunities. Machine learning, a subset of artificial intelligence, has emerged as a powerful tool in predictive analytics, revolutionizing the way organizations leverage their data to make accurate predictions.

At its core, predictive analytics involves the use of historical and real-time data to identify patterns, relationships, and trends that can help predict future outcomes. Traditional statistical methods have been used for decades, but with the advent of machine learning, predictive analytics has taken a giant leap forward. Machine learning algorithms can analyze massive amounts of data, learn from patterns and insights, and make informed predictions without explicit programming instructions.

One of the key advantages of machine learning in predictive analytics is its ability to handle complex and unstructured data. Traditional statistical methods often struggle with data that does not fit a predetermined model or structure. Machine learning algorithms, on the other hand, can analyze a wide variety of data sources, including text, images, and social media feeds, to uncover hidden patterns and develop accurate predictions. This enables organizations to leverage previously untapped data sources and gain deeper insights into customer behavior, market trends, and business dynamics.

Machine learning algorithms can be broadly classified into two categories: supervised learning and unsupervised learning. Supervised learning involves training a model with labeled data, where the outcome is known and provided as input to the algorithm. The algorithm then learns the underlying patterns and relationships in the data, allowing it to make predictions on new, unlabeled data. This type of learning is particularly useful in scenarios where historical data is available and can be used to predict future outcomes accurately.

Unsupervised learning, on the other hand, involves training a model with unlabeled data, where there is no predefined outcome or labels. The algorithm identifies patterns, clusters, and relationships in the data without any prior knowledge of the expected outcomes. Unsupervised learning is valuable in scenarios where the organization wants to explore and discover hidden patterns and insights within the data. It can be particularly helpful in identifying customer segments, detecting anomalies, and discovering new trends and patterns in unstructured data.

Machine learning algorithms can also be used for reinforcement learning, where an agent learns to take actions in an environment to maximize a reward signal. This type of learning is often used in optimization problems, such as inventory management or dynamic pricing. The agent learns through trial and error, continually improving its decision-making capabilities based on feedback and rewards.

The role of machine learning in predictive analytics extends beyond just making accurate predictions. These algorithms can also help organizations understand the underlying driving factors and insights that contribute to specific outcomes. By analyzing the importance and impact of various features in the data, machine learning models can provide valuable insights into customer preferences, purchasing behavior, and market dynamics. This allows organizations to develop targeted strategies, personalize customer experiences, and proactively respond to changing market conditions.

However, it is important to note that machine learning algorithms are not a magical solution that can provide 100% accurate predictions. The accuracy of predictions depends on the quality and relevance of input data, the appropriate selection of algorithms, and the model’s ability to generalize to new, unseen data. Developing robust machine learning models requires careful data preparation, feature engineering, and rigorous validation processes. It also requires continuous monitoring and refinement to ensure the models remain accurate and up-to-date.

In conclusion, machine learning has revolutionized the field of predictive analytics by enabling organizations to leverage extensive datasets, handle unstructured data, and make accurate predictions. Supervised learning, unsupervised learning, and reinforcement learning techniques have enabled organizations to gain deeper insights into customer behavior, market trends, and business dynamics. Machine learning algorithms not only make accurate predictions but also provide valuable insights into the underlying factors and driving forces. As organizations continue to collect and analyze vast amounts of data, machine learning will play an increasingly vital role in predictive analytics, empowering organizations to make data-driven decisions and stay ahead in today’s competitive landscape.

Related posts

How Machine Learning is Transforming Customer Service and Chatbots

admin

A beginner’s guide to coding languages

admin

A Beginner’s Guide to Technical Writing

admin